**Specialty Centers and Services**
The availability of specialized services is a key indicator of a hospital's ability to provide comprehensive breast cancer care. These services include:
* **Surgical Oncology:** Breast surgeons specializing in breast cancer surgery, including lumpectomy, mastectomy, and sentinel lymph node biopsy.
* **Medical Oncology:** Medical oncologists who administer chemotherapy, targeted therapy, and immunotherapy.
* **Radiation Oncology:** Radiation oncologists who provide radiation therapy.
* **Breast Imaging:** Access to advanced imaging techniques like 3D mammography (tomosynthesis), ultrasound, and MRI.
* **Pathology:** Accurate and timely pathology services for diagnosis and staging.
* **Genetic Counseling and Testing:** Services to assess a patient's risk of developing breast cancer and determine if they carry genetic mutations.
* **Reconstructive Surgery:** Plastic surgeons specializing in breast reconstruction following mastectomy.
* **Supportive Care:** Services like physical therapy, occupational therapy, nutritional counseling, and psychological support.

**Additional Considerations:**
* **Accreditation:** Look for hospitals accredited by organizations like the American College of Surgeons' Commission on Cancer (CoC). This accreditation signifies that the hospital meets specific standards for cancer care.
* **Patient Experience:** Read patient reviews and testimonials to gain insights into the quality of care and patient satisfaction. Websites like Healthgrades and Vitals can provide this information.
* **Clinical Trials:** Consider whether the hospital participates in clinical trials, which can provide access to innovative treatments.
* **Insurance Coverage:** Verify that the hospital and its providers are in your insurance network.
